基础的语句
Posted zq5252
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了基础的语句相关的知识,希望对你有一定的参考价值。
程序的三大结构
顺序
选择
循环
Boolean*
强制类型的转换
所有非零的数字都为true 0 为 false
所有非空字符串都为true 空字符串 false
[]数组 、 对象 都为true null \ undefined false
if
作用
if()else 常用来判断范围。。。
if分支
单分支:执行逻辑:对条件进行判断,如果条件返回值为true 则执行
var hunry = true;
console.log("睡觉");
双分支:
var year=2001;
if(year % 4 == 0 && year % 100 !=0 || year %400==0)
console.log("闰年");
else
console.log("平年");
多分支:
var money =99999;
if(money>0 && money<100)
console.log("100以内");
else if(money>100 && money<1000)
console.log("100-1000");
else
console.log("不在范围内");
条件的判断
当不为0的纯数字 则返回真 0 false
非空字符串 返回true "" false
所有对象、数组 返回true null、undefined false
当一个函数存在的时候,则为真,否则为假
switch
语法
switch()
case value : 执行的语句 ; // 对某个固定值的判断。
1: case穿透。
如果每一个case语句执行完毕之后,没有遇到 break , 让程序继续往下执行。
2: default 其他情况,
以上case值都不满足的情况下所执行的语句。 可以省略掉。
while
循环
var i=1;
while(i<=100)
document.write("我爱你"+i+" ");
i++;
循环的作用:
1:简化代码,处理重复执行的代码
2:遍历数组、json对象、节点集合。
语法:
while(循环的条件)
循环体
循环的五大要素
1.循环变量
2.循环变量的初始值
3.循环的增值
4.循环的终止条件
5.循环体
计算器
业务逻辑:
1.点击btn之后
2.对两给输入框的值进行获取
3.判断运算符
4.运算得出结果
5.把结果放在res里面 -->
文本框值的获取 文本框的id名称.value;
语法:
id名称.onclick = function()
事件处理程序
box.onclick = function()
alert("点我了")
以上是关于基础的语句的主要内容,如果未能解决你的问题,请参考以下文章